Tips for Choosing the Right Yogurt Cultures

Yogurt is a nutritious and delicious food that has been consumed by humans for thousands of years. It is made by fermenting milk with bacteria cultures, which convert lactose into lactic acid. This process gives yogurt its tangy taste and thick texture. If you are interested in making your own yogurt at home, you need to choose the right yogurt cultures that will provide you with the best quality and flavor. Here are some tips to help you select the right yogurt cultures.
1. Consider the Type of Milk
The type of milk you use will have a significant impact on the outcome of your homemade yogurt. Different milk types have different levels of fat, protein, and lactose, which will affect the fermentation process. For example, if you use whole milk, you will get a creamier and thicker yogurt than if you use skim milk. If you use non-dairy milk such as soy, almond, or coconut milk, you will need to choose yogurt cultures that are suitable for that milk type.
2. Choose the Right Strains
Yogurt cultures can be made up of different strains of bacteria that have different properties, such as acidity, flavor, and thickness. When choosing yogurt cultures, look for strains that will give you the texture and taste you desire. For example, if you want a thick and creamy yogurt, choose cultures that contain the strains Lactobacillus bulgaricus and Streptococcus thermophilus. If you like a tangy flavor, choose cultures that contain Lactobacillus acidophilus.
3. Look for Live and Active Cultures
When choosing yogurt cultures, look for products that contain live and active cultures. These are the beneficial bacteria that ferment the milk and convert lactose into lactic acid. They also promote good gut health. Some brands of yogurt cultures may be heat-treated or pasteurized, which kills the live bacteria. Choose products that have not been treated in this way to ensure that you get the full benefits of the fermentation process.
4. Check the Expiration Date
Yogurt cultures are living organisms, and they have a limited lifespan. Check the expiration date on the packaging before purchasing the product to make sure that the bacteria are still alive and active. If the product is past its expiration date, the bacteria may have died, and the yogurt may not ferment properly, resulting in a poor-quality product.

6. Consider the Packaging
Yogurt cultures come in different forms - some are powdered, and others are liquid. Consider the packaging and how it will fit into your yogurt-making process. Powdered cultures require rehydration in milk before being added to the yogurt mixture, while liquid cultures can be added directly. Choose the type of culture that works best for your recipe and preferences.
7. Check for Allergens
If you or anyone in your family has allergies or food intolerances, make sure to check the packaging for potential allergens such as milk, soy, or gluten. Some yogurt cultures may contain additives or flavorings that could also cause allergic reactions. Choose a product that is free of any allergens that you or your family may be sensitive to, and always follow the instructions on the packaging carefully.
